Here's the real talk about yards in Villa Rica: that Carroll County clay is dense, compacted, and honestly fights you every season. When you're looking at artificial turf, you're eliminating the constant battle against drainage issues and dead patches. Our area gets solid sun exposure, especially in the Mirror Lake neighborhoods, which actually works *in your favor* with synthetic systems—no UV degradation on quality turf, and better drainage than natural grass in our climate. Lot sizes around Villa Rica tend to be moderate, which makes installation straightforward and cost-effective. One thing we always check: HOA rules. Some neighborhoods have specific guidelines about turf brands or pile heights, so we make sure you're compliant before we break ground. The west metro growth means a lot of newer construction with established landscaping plans, so we can work within existing hardscaping and design. Installation-wise, we prep that clay base properly, ensuring water doesn't pool—crucial in our area where heavy summer rains are common. The artificial turf handles our heat without the burn-out issues you'd see with natural grass, and winter dormancy isn't even a concern.
